Welcome to Platte River Academy

Welcome to the website for Platte River Academy (PRA), a K-8 Core Knowledge charter school located in Highlands Ranch, Colorado.  This year (2010-11) marks our 14th year in the business of providing a quality education for students in Douglas County.

Our Mission:

Provide a content-rich academically rigorous education with a well-defined, sequential curriculum in a safe, orderly and caring environment.

(From PRA's original Charter - 1997)
 

 
 
   
 
 


Platte River Academy (PRA) believes a challenging curriculum mastered by students creates high self-esteem and involvement in active learning. Students are treated as unique individuals. PRA ability groups students and sets high standards for academics and appropriate behavior. Staff and community are united with parents in teaching the building blocks for character development and informed citizenship including responsibility, respect, integrity, and compassion. We value children as unique individuals and encourage them to become lifelong learners and valuable members of our school community and global society.
